LeetCode16——3Sum Closest

时间:2015-03-12 00:59:36      阅读:321      评论:0      收藏:0      [点我收藏+]

Given an array S of n integers, find three integers in S such that the sum is closest to a given number, target. Return the sum of the three integers. You may assume that each input would have exactly one solution.

For example, given array S = {-1 2 1 -4}, and target = 1.

The sum that is closest to the target is 2. (-1 + 2 + 1 = 2).

难度系数: 中等

实现:

int threeSumClosest(vector<int> &num, int target) {
    std::sort(num.begin(), num.end());
    int closestVal = INT_MAX;
    int closestSum = 0;
    int small, big;
    for (int i = 0; i < num.size() - 2; ++i){
        small = i+1;
        big = num.size()-1;
        while (small < big) {
            int sum = num[small] + num[big] + num[i];
            int absVal = abs(sum - target);
            if (absVal < closestVal) {
                closestVal = absVal;
                closestSum = sum;
                cout << closestSum << endl;
            }
            if (sum > target) {
                big--;
            } else {
                small++;
            }
        }
    }
    return closestSum;
}
